Parish Council meetings during the COVID-19 pandemic

The law has been temporarily changed to allow parish council meetings to be conducted by audio or video link with participants not in the same physical location. NALC guidance has been issued.

Parish Councils are normally required to hold an annual meeting of the council during May and elect a chairman for the coming year. The law also required an annual meeting of the parish electors to take place between 1st March and 1st June. Both of these requirements have been suspended.
